macroevolution: (Default)
macroevolution ([personal profile] macroevolution) wrote2011-09-06 06:51 pm

Учебная моделька для демонстрации возможностей отбора

С 1-го сентября я читаю лекции, две пары в неделю, первокурсникам - будущим экономистам ("совместный бакалвриат РЭШ и ВШЭ"). Мой курс официально называется "введение в науки о жизни". Интересно (мне и, надеюсь, детям тоже), но пока уходит очень много времени на подготовку лекций (это не совсем лекции, а наполовину семинары: с вопросами, домашними заданиями, которые надо проверять, и т.п.) Если честно - практически всё время уходит. Собираюсь кое-что объяснять при помощи простых компьютерных моделей. Уже сделал одну: для демонстрации того, чем естественный отбор отличается от случайного поиска (почему обезьяна, случайно нажимая на клавиши, никогда не напечатает Гамлета, а алгоритм "мутации + отбор" - таки напечатает).  Идея этой программы, как внимательные читатели этого блога знают прекрасно, взята из книги Докинза "Слепой часовщик". Только у меня там есть пара дополнительных возможностей: например, можно регулировать темп мутагенеза. И, соответственно, можно убедиться в том, что существует некий оптимальный темп: если мутации происходят слишком часто, отбор не может довести эволюционирующую последовательность до идеала. Если слишком редко - доведет, но потратит больше времени. И можно посмотреть, как именно будет вести себя эволюционирующая последовательность, если отбор не справляется с мутациями ("генетическое вырождение" - это вовсе не однонаправленный и необратимый уход от оптимума, а движение к некому вполне определенному равновесному состоянию). Это игрушечка, конечно. С вполне определенными и ограниченными задачами. И да, я знаю, чем моделируемая ситация отличается от реальной эволюции :)
если кто хочет поиграть: можно скачать программку, она в Access. Левая кнопка - отбор, правая - случайное блуждание, верхнее окошко - исходная последовательность (можно набрать любую), маленькое окошечко посередине - скорость мутагенеза (вероятность мутации на особь на букву на поколение). В общем, разобраться там не очень трудно.

[identity profile] oldodik.livejournal.com 2011-09-06 04:47 pm (UTC)(link)
Ну, это Докинз задавал конкретную фразу. Ему интересно было, насколько быстро направленный отбор выведет его на "Ту би о нот ту би". И я здесь именно докинзовский подход, критикуемый гег-морозом, слегка защищаю.

А в программку сам и не играл пока))

[identity profile] http://users.livejournal.com/_glav_/ 2011-09-06 04:54 pm (UTC)(link)
а, понятно..

ну для поставленной задачи ("чем естественный отбор отличается от случайного поиска"), имхо наличие цели "не нарушает общности".
главное, помнить об этом при построении дальнейших рассуждений :)

[identity profile] oldodik.livejournal.com 2011-09-06 04:58 pm (UTC)(link)
Что-то мне подсказывает, что и А.В. своим студентам объясняет ровно то же самое))

[identity profile] oldodik.livejournal.com 2011-09-07 06:07 am (UTC)(link)
Вот Александр поясняет: http://macroevolution.livejournal.com/65380.html?thread=3171172#t3171172

По-моему, красота, и упреки снимаются. действительно.